The rout of PSG against Manchester City on Wednesday evening once again highlighted an incredible number of problems in a team yet sensible - at least on paper - to roll on Europe of football.

We could have devoted an entire article to each of these shortcomings, but there are so many that we preferred to opt for a small condensed version of wet finger notation, you will not blame us.

  • A team cut in two

Rereading our notes, we came across this hastily scribbled sentence: “3 in front, everything else behind and inch'Allah brothers! ". From memory, it was at the very beginning of the meeting, when PSG offered one of its rare counter-attacks of the match. After a ball recovery in front of the defense, the ball is quickly raised by Neymar, who combines with Messi, who combines with Mbappé. Problem, when he wanted to seek support in withdrawal, there was no living soul. This is all the misfortune of this PSG: with three players of the caliber of the MNM, Paris seems to believe that it is enough to swing the ball far in front of them for the lightning to fall on the adversaries.

Severity of the situation: 3/10.

 We're going to be nice to begin with.

First because it will not be every day Manchester City (and its crazy pressing) opposite, and then because with players of the quality of Hakimi and Nuno Mendes on the sides, not to mention Verratti which will end up one day by returning to a field, Paris should still be able to project in numbers when the opportunities arise.

  • An attacking trio that refuses to defend

Now let's take the problem backwards. If the leading trio is not much supported in the offensive phase, what about the defensive support of the three frontiers… Wednesday evening, while the waves were breaking on the goals of Navas, what was the MNM doing? She wasn't jogging, no, she was walking. They barely deigned to take a look at what was going on behind their backs. That Neymar, Mbappé and Messi do not hurt themselves to help the withdrawal against Angers, Metz or Bordeaux still passes, but here we are talking about Manchester City. After the meeting, Marquinhos raised his voice: “We tried to defend well but they were superior on the sides. The defensive aspect is a collective aspect, everyone has to do better. "

Severity of the situation: 9/10.

Why such a fear?

This is what we said above: if the three in front do not see fit to come and interfere with the opposing raises in a match of such importance, against a team of the caliber of Manchester City, how can we imagine that they decide to change anything in the future?

Impossible.

Paris therefore seems condemned to having to defend at 7, and therefore to say goodbye to its dreams of a collective team which is united together.

Only positive point: they had more or less done it in the first leg (well, especially Neymar), it is therefore that they are capable of it the bastards.

  • An unrecognizable team without Verratti in the middle

The game against City and the way in which PSG were unable to properly release the ball under pressure reminded us of how much there is a Paris with Verratti and a Paris without. On Wednesday, not a player of the three in the middle (Gueye, Paredes, Herrera) managed to properly release the ball to get rid of the pressure from Mancun. In truth, if the attacking trio monopolizes all the light on him, the real master at playing, the metronome, the one who dictates the tempo and gets you out of the mud when the opponent is at the pressing, it is the Little Owl. .

Severity of the situation: 6/10.

Until now, we had grown used to seeing Verratti and his crepe paper body only about every other match.

The fault of repeated injuries and a healthy lifestyle not always conducive to high level football.

From now on, the Italian is becoming even rarer and we wonder one day if he will manage to make a full season without farting.

Present the day before the match in conf, he explained the happiness that was his to play such a meeting of C1.

Except that in the meantime Verratti has resumed a farce in training, the rest we know.

In the future, PSG would do well to invest in a profile similar to his or else having to struggle in the middle of 3/4 of the season.

  • Still no collective identity

We are not going to discuss this subject for long since we have not stopped talking about it since the start of the season, even since the start of the year, even since the departure of Laurent Blanc.

PSG suffers from a deep evil, that of not being a football team but an addition of individuals.

No preferential circuits in the game, no tactical consistency, a glaring lack of collective creativity.

On Wednesday, the difference with the perfectly set clock that is Pep Guardiola's Manchester City was scary to see.

A soccer team against soccer players is stupid but it makes all the difference.
